Output bf85af995718b23da5adb5ef51e88d1fcf95013a41f1953b9512bcedf0a0650b:0

value
149890277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d35f34cf8761a0d9509973238f7e401d1305e1a8 OP_EQUAL
address
MTAnrxNcvTAHmeFDgpn21kh2NvcExhYp5n
transaction
bf85af995718b23da5adb5ef51e88d1fcf95013a41f1953b9512bcedf0a0650b
spent
true